A member asked:

I had unprotected sex around the time of ovulation and took plan b within an hour. will plan b work even if i'm ovulating or ovulated already?

High risk : Having sex around the time of ovulation is a high-risk situation for pregnancy. If sex was within 72 hours and you do not desire pregnancy consider taking plan b. It's available over-the-counter and decreases the risk of an unplanned pregnancy. Also consider scheduling a visit to discuss your birth control options to prevent the situation in the future.
